Output 6236b40f2f06d4a794020425c2248662861c71496fac4dfbffb93bacea84d534:66

value
3537276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75516a75754b7e2090b50812e9ff1df645114061 OP_EQUAL
address
MJbUpkHXRSYvLMPhu6ArbzYp1SAYWEjnhW
transaction
6236b40f2f06d4a794020425c2248662861c71496fac4dfbffb93bacea84d534
spent
true